Countable/Uncountable Nouns Englannin kieliopin harjoitukset


Lasketeltavien ja laskemattomien substantiivien harjoitus 1


Lasketeltavat ja laskemattomat substantiivit ovat keskeinen osa englannin kielioppia. Ne määrittävät, miten substantiivit toimivat lauseessa ja kuinka niitä tulee käyttää. Lasketeltavat substantiivit viittaavat asioihin, joita voidaan laskea (esim. yksi koira, kaksi koiraa), kun taas laskemattomat substantiivit viittaavat materiaaleihin tai asioihin, joita ei pääsääntöisesti voida laskea yksilöllisesti (esim. vesi, ilma). Näiden kahden kategorian ymmärtäminen auttaa opiskelijoita käyttämään artikkeleita (a, an, the) ja kvantifikaattoreita (some, any, much, many) oikein.

Lasketeltavien ja laskemattomien substantiivien harjoitus 1

The recipe calls for two *cups* (unit) of sugar and a pinch of salt.

Is there any *milk* (uncountable) left in the fridge?

She bought a bunch of *flowers* (countable) for her mother’s birthday.

Please add a little more *rice* (uncountable) to my bowl.

I only have three *apples* (countable) left in the basket.

During the summer, we get a lot of *sunshine* (uncountable) here.

We need to buy a few more *chairs* (countable) for the dining room.

Do you think a *piece* (count) of cake is enough for everyone?

There’s hardly any *room* (uncountable) for more guests in the conference hall.

They have over a thousand *books* (countable) in their library.

I don’t have much *patience* (uncountable) for this kind of delay.

There are several *cats* (countable) lounging on the porch.

You need to pour some *water* (uncountable) into the pot before boiling.

Please pass me that bowl of *strawberries* (countable).

He has a great deal of *knowledge* (uncountable) on the subject.

Lasketeltavien ja laskemattomien substantiivien harjoitus 2

Can you lend me a *dollar* (countable)?

In the morning, I like drinking fresh *orange juice* (uncountable).

We saw several *pigeons* (countable) in the park yesterday.

I prefer not to add too much *salt* (uncountable) to my food.

His room is full of *posters* (countable) of his favorite bands.

You need to show a bit more *respect* (uncountable) to elders.

She has a collection of rare *coins* (countable).

There is a lot of *snow* (uncountable) on the ground this winter.

The teacher asked for the homework *assignments* (countable).

He doesn’t have any *siblings* (countable).

There is always plenty of *entertainment* (uncountable) in the city.

Look at all these colorful *marbles* (countable)!

She offered me some *advice* (uncountable) on how to improve my resume.

How many *eggs* (countable) do we need to make an omelet?

You require more *experience* (uncountable) to handle a project of this size.
